Product Detailed Parameters
- Description:IC FPGA 696 I/O 1517FBGA
- Series:Stratix® V GS
- Mfr:Altera
- Package:Tray
- Number of LABs/CLBs:262400
- Number of Logic Elements/Cells:695000
- Total RAM Bits:51200000
- Number of I/O:696
- Voltage - Supply:0.82V ~ 0.88V
- Mounting Type:Surface Mount
- Operating Temperature:-40°C ~ 100°C (TJ)
- Package / Case:1517-BBGA, FCBGA
- Supplier Device Package:1517-FBGA (40x40)

Overview
The Altera 5SGSMD8K3F40I4N is a Stratix V GS Field Programmable Gate Array featuring 695,000 logic elements and 262,400 adaptive logic modules. It integrates 50 Mbit of embedded memory and supports data rates up to 14.1 Gb/s via 36 transceivers. The device operates at a core voltage of 0.82V to 0.88V within an industrial temperature range of -40°C to 100°C TJ, housed in a 1517-ball FBGA package.
